History

The park was created in 1966 when the state leased acreage that included Script error: No such module "convert". of water frontage from Consumers Power Company.[2]

Activities and amenities

The park offers swimming, fishing for bass, walleye and panfish, boat launch, picnicking, playground, and 99 rustic campsites.[1]
